ORDER
Seeking to direct the 2nd respondent not to harass the petitioner under the guise of enquiry, on basis of the petitioner's representation dated 23.02.2026., this criminal original petition is filed.
2. When the matter is taken up for hearing, the learned Government Advocate(Crl.Side) submitted that in this case, enquiry has been conducted and the case was closed.
3. Recording the same, this Criminal Original Petition is dismissed.
